Output e6aab2eb87811bbce4fd481db1585f9806caea714eb2ca8fd97f4701d274b06b:0

value
381245614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aafde0bc6bd4264442d4463ea19db3cb30cbc55 OP_EQUAL
address
373Ko9armZTVtTiMrhw5o7qF8xWPkAYnGU
transaction
e6aab2eb87811bbce4fd481db1585f9806caea714eb2ca8fd97f4701d274b06b
confirmations
320959
spent
true